How do genetics impact cholesterol levels?

Genetics play a significant role in determining your cholesterol levels. Some individuals inherit genes that cause their bodies to produce more cholesterol or process it less efficiently. This genetic predisposition, known as familial hypercholesterolemia, can lead to high cholesterol levels regardless of diet or lifestyle. In fact, about 1 in 250 people have this condition, which can cause elevated LDL (bad) cholesterol from birth.

Even without this specific condition, your genetic makeup can influence how your body responds to dietary cholesterol and fat. Some people are more sensitive to dietary cholesterol, while others can consume higher amounts without significant impact on their blood cholesterol levels.

What role does age play in cholesterol management?

As we age, our bodies undergo various changes that can affect cholesterol levels. Generally, cholesterol levels tend to rise with age, particularly in women after menopause. This is partly due to hormonal changes and a natural decline in the liver’s ability to remove LDL cholesterol from the bloodstream.

Additionally, age-related factors such as decreased physical activity, changes in metabolism, and the cumulative effects of long-term dietary habits can contribute to higher cholesterol levels. This is why regular cholesterol screening becomes increasingly important as we get older, even for those who have maintained healthy levels in the past.

How do underlying health conditions affect cholesterol?

Several health conditions can significantly impact cholesterol levels, often independently of diet. Diabetes, for instance, can lower HDL (good) cholesterol and increase LDL cholesterol and triglycerides. This is due to insulin resistance affecting how the body processes and stores fat.

Thyroid disorders can also influence cholesterol levels. An underactive thyroid (hypothyroidism) can lead to increased LDL cholesterol, while an overactive thyroid (hyperthyroidism) may result in abnormally low cholesterol levels. Other conditions like kidney disease, liver disease, and polycystic ovary syndrome (PCOS) can also affect cholesterol metabolism.

Why are exercise and sleep crucial for cholesterol control?

Regular physical activity is a powerful tool for managing cholesterol levels. Exercise helps increase HDL cholesterol while reducing LDL cholesterol and triglycerides. It also promotes weight loss and improves insulin sensitivity, both of which contribute to better cholesterol profiles.

Interestingly, sleep also plays a vital role in cholesterol management. Chronic sleep deprivation has been linked to higher LDL cholesterol levels and lower HDL cholesterol. This is likely due to the impact of sleep on hormones that regulate appetite, metabolism, and stress—all of which can affect cholesterol levels.

How does stress management impact cholesterol levels?

Chronic stress can have a significant impact on cholesterol levels, often in ways that aren’t immediately obvious. When stressed, the body releases cortisol and other stress hormones, which can trigger an increase in LDL cholesterol and a decrease in HDL cholesterol. Stress can also lead to unhealthy behaviors like overeating, especially of high-fat and high-sugar foods, which can further impact cholesterol levels.

Implementing stress-reduction techniques such as meditation, yoga, or regular exercise can help manage stress-related cholesterol changes. These practices not only reduce stress but also promote overall heart health and well-being.

What are some unique approaches to cholesterol management?

While diet remains an important factor in cholesterol management, exploring alternative strategies can provide additional benefits. For instance, some studies suggest that intermittent fasting may help improve cholesterol profiles by reducing LDL cholesterol and triglycerides. Additionally, incorporating specific foods like oats, nuts, and fatty fish into your diet can have a more pronounced effect on cholesterol levels than simply avoiding high-cholesterol foods.

In the United States, there’s growing interest in personalized nutrition approaches to cholesterol management. This involves tailoring dietary recommendations based on an individual’s genetic profile, lifestyle, and specific health needs. While still an emerging field, this personalized approach shows promise in providing more effective strategies for managing cholesterol levels.

How do different cholesterol treatments compare?

When lifestyle changes alone aren’t sufficient to manage cholesterol levels, medical treatments may be necessary. Here’s a comparison of some common cholesterol treatments:


Treatment How It Works Potential Benefits Considerations
Statins Blocks cholesterol production in the liver Significantly lowers LDL cholesterol May cause muscle pain in some people
Bile Acid Sequestrants Binds to bile acids, indirectly lowering cholesterol Can be used with statins for enhanced effect May cause gastrointestinal side effects
PCSK9 Inhibitors Enhances liver’s ability to remove LDL from blood Very effective at lowering LDL cholesterol Administered by injection, can be costly
Ezetimibe Reduces cholesterol absorption in the intestine Can be used alone or with statins Generally well-tolerated, fewer side effects
Fibrates Lowers triglycerides and may increase HDL Effective for those with high triglycerides May increase risk of muscle damage when combined with statins
